Output e8cb2da852438bf790591f13f95f56edfc0c8178622d51d3913de7cd81f3f9b2:2

value
2347093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c78efdef55ea1844c7b88a0af3f6aff66d5b675 OP_EQUAL
address
3MnmTbXxtpfZiBezSyEC2saEGv9aXAJFof
transaction
e8cb2da852438bf790591f13f95f56edfc0c8178622d51d3913de7cd81f3f9b2
confirmations
336198
spent
true